Holly Starcross

UK Publisher: Andersen Press

Holly’s world came apart when she was six, when her mother took her, and ran away from her father and his farm. From that day on she has had no contact with him, and can barely remember him. But eight years later, with a new family around her, she feels very alone and longs for that half-remembered life.

A mysteriously familiar man starts driving around and asking after her and Holly is forced to explore the long-forgotten life her mother ran away from eight years before, and find out who she really is.

This is an absorbing and moving book about identity, fatherhood and family.
